How Ceiling Water Extraction Works: A Step-by-Step Guide

Our team’s process for ceiling water extraction is carefully designed to reduce damage and restore your property to its original state. We understand that every situation is unique, which is why we take a personalized approach to each job. When you call us, our technicians will arrive quickly and assess the damage to find out the best course of action.

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

Our IICRC-certified technicians will carefully inspect your ceiling and surrounding areas to find out the extent of the damage. They’ll look for signs of water intrusion, such as discoloration, warping, or sagging, and identify any potential sources of the problem.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using advanced equipment, our technicians will extract as much water as possible from your ceiling and surrounding areas.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ected areas. This ensures that your property is completely free of moisture, reducing the risk of future damage and promoting a healthy environment.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

After the drying process is complete, our technicians will th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.

Step 5: Repair and Restoration

Finally, our team will repair and restore your ceiling and surrounding areas to their original state. This may involve replacing damaged drywall, painting, or applying new finishes to match the original look and feel of your property.

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Water Extraction

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Be on the lookout for these common indicators of ceiling water extraction needs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of moisture buildup in your ceiling. If you notice a musty smell that won’t dissipate, it’s essential to investigate the source and address the issue quickly.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on your ceiling or walls can be a clear indication of water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

Sagging or Warped Ceiling

A sagging or warped ceiling is a serious sign of water damage. If you notice your ceiling is sagging or warped, it’s crucial to contact our team immediately to prevent further dam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of moisture buildup in your ceiling.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ks from your ceiling can be a sign of water damage. If you notice these signs, don’t hesitate to contact our team to schedule a ceiling water extraction service.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age, such as water droplets or puddles, is a clear indication of a problem. If you notice water damage on your ceiling or surrounding areas, contact our team immediately to prevent further damage.

Ceiling Water Extraction Cost in Fairview, TX

The cost of ceiling water extraction services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Fairview, TX. As a general estimate,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a typical ceiling water extraction service. But, this cost can range from $1,000 to $5,000 or more for more extensive dam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ment used
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, equipment used, and duration of drying process
Cleaning and Sanitizing $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of cleaning products used, and duration of cleaning process
Repair and Restoration $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and materials used
Inspection and Assessment $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of damage, and equipment used
Equipment Rental $50 – $200 Duration of rental, type of equipment used, and rental company fees

Keep in mind that these estimates are subject to change based on the specifics of your situation. Our team will provide a free on-site assessment to find out the exact cost of the services you need.

Common Questions About Ceiling Water Extraction

Q: What causes ceiling water extraction needs?

A: Ceiling water extraction needs can be caused by various factors, including heavy rainfall, burst pipes, roof leaks, and appliance malfunctions. Ignoring these signs can lead to costly repairs and health hazards, making it essential to address the issue quickly.

Q: How long does the ceiling water extraction process take?

A: The duration of the ceiling water extraction process can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, our team can complete the process within 3-5 days, but in some cases, it may take longer.

Q: Is ceiling water extraction covered by insurance?

A: In most cases, ceiling water extraction services are covered by homeowners’ insurance policies. But, it’s essential to check your policy and contact your insurance provider to find out the specifics of your coverage.

Q: What happens if I ignore ceiling water extraction needs?

A: Ignoring ceiling water extraction needs can lead to costly repairs, health hazards, and even structural damage to your property. It’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and ensure a safe living environment.

Q: Can I perform ceiling water extraction myself?

A: While DIY might seem like a cost-effective solution, it’s not recommended for ceiling water extraction. This process need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ure a thorough and effective restoration process.
